John Koller has revealed a few more things about the PSP's recently-announced lineup in an interview with MTV Multiplayer. Nothing really big concerning the already revealed titles was announced in the interview apart from Assassin's Creed being a "completely different game, unique to the PSP", but Koller says that all we've heard is just the tip of the iceberg:

The announcements we made are half the story. There's another half still to be announced in the next couple of months-slash E3. A lot of first and third-party titles that are coming in the back half of the year want to hold their announcement until E3 timeframe. There's a few pretty 'majors' coming still in that franchise line, but we wanted to whet people's appetite.
